Description
Warm, savory kolache buns filled with cheddar cheese and sausage, made from sourdough discard.
Ingredients
Scale
- 2 cups sourdough discard
- 2 cups all-purpose flour
- 1/2 cup milk
- 1/4 cup sugar
- 1/2 cup cheddar cheese, grated
- 1 package (2 1/4 tsp) active dry yeast
- 2 large eggs
- 1/2 teaspoon salt
- 1 cup cooked sausage, crumbled
- 1/4 cup melted butter
Instructions
- Combine sourdough discard, milk, and sugar in a bowl; mix well.
- Add yeast and let it sit for about 5 minutes until frothy.
- Incorporate eggs, melted butter, and salt into the mixture.
- Gradually stir in the flour until a soft dough forms.
- Knead the dough on a floured surface for about 5 minutes until smooth.
- Place in a greased bowl, cover, and let rise for 1 hour until doubled in size.
- Preheat oven to 375°F (190°C) and prepare a greased baking sheet.
- Punch down the dough and roll into balls.
- Make a well in the center of each ball and fill with crumbled sausage and cheese.
- Close the dough around the filling and place on a greased baking sheet.
- Let them rise for another 20 minutes.
- Bake for 15-20 minutes until golden brown.
- Allow to cool slightly before serving.
Notes
Store buns in an airtight container for up to 2 days at room temperature, or freeze for up to 3 months.
